Original Description
Jane Nasmyth’s Cattle In A Wooded Parkland transports viewers into a serene pastoral scene brimming with natural harmony. The painting, executed in the Romantic tradition of the early 19th century, showcases Nasmyth’s meticulous attention to verdant landscapes and livestock—a hallmark of her father’s (Alexander Nasmyth) artistic influence. Bathed in soft golden light filtering through leafy canopies, the composition balances tranquil cattle grazing amidst dappled shadows with a sense of quiet grandeur. This work exemplifies the Scottish Enlightenment’s reverence for nature and rural life, bridging picturesque idealism with keen observation. Though less renowned than contemporaries like Constable or Turner, Nasmyth’s works hold significance in British landscape painting for their intimate scale and lyrical realism, offering a feminine perspective often overlooked in her era.
